Output ec11605b3d5a26dc88b74b46a88a5015c7d6f664fa48ace7a1428bc796205660:3

value
70180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a48006a86e3c8025edf8f87bbe3ff2b63495a31b OP_EQUAL
address
3Ggp7QZ3YEdi8vjvqxMv9XpAFW5GR5Ad43
transaction
ec11605b3d5a26dc88b74b46a88a5015c7d6f664fa48ace7a1428bc796205660
spent
true